Transaction 52c66cb59ea4ac2821a1375cd8187856638bfd3415fc421183ef7676c1c6f2a5
1 Input
1 Output
-
52c66cb59ea4ac2821a1375cd8187856638bfd3415fc421183ef7676c1c6f2a5:0
- value
- 189500
- script pubkey
- OP_0 OP_PUSHBYTES_20 07825b2afc946d900b9fb797569426c4c937a016
- address
- bc1qq7p9k2huj3keqzulk7t4d9pxcnyn0gqk3t9haj